Bad airline coffee is an indignity few travellers want to suffer through, especially on those early morning flights that require you to leave your home before the crack of dawn.
Luckily, Porter Airlines has teamed up with Café Saint-Henri to bring high-quality, sustainably-sourced coffee to the skies.
All Porter routes will serve the specialty brew, crafted to deliver rich flavour, at altitude. “This coffee is carefully selected and roasted to enhance its taste in-flight,” said Thibaut Paggen, coffee department manager, Café Saint-Henri. “At altitude, sensory perception changes. It was important to consider all these factors in the creation of this coffee, from selecting the beans at their origin to roasting them here in Montréal.”
Café Saint-Henri is a Montréal institution, known for its premium coffee blends. Porter is pleased to add it as a catering partner in its list of Canadian products.
“Porter’s partnership with Café Saint-Henri offers passengers an unrivaled in-flight coffee experience,” said Julian Low, vice president, corporate development, Porter Airlines. “This is a welcome addition to our complimentary catering menu, featuring premium Canadian partners who emulate our values.”
